What will you be doing?

As PA to Headteacher is a central role in the school administration, which is varied,
demanding and rewarding. The role ranges from arranging daily teaching cover, organising daily
briefings to staff, dealing with the Headteacher’s correspondence to the management of recruitment and much more.
Other responsibilities include:
  • To provide confidential PA support to the Headteacher including management of special and confidential correspondence, co-ordinating internal meetings, schedule appointments, diary and email corresepondence.
  • Screen incoming enquiries and greet important external visitors.
  • To liaise with school staff, students and others outside the school, particularly parents, and representatives of the Local Educational Authority, Governors, Parents and Teachers.
  • Prepare agendas, presentation documents, spreadsheets and reports for the Headteacher.
  • Collate reports for Governors’ meetings / Headteacher reports.
  • To co-ordinate internal meetings, schedule appointments and support for the Headteacher
  • To liaise with the Headteacher, Chair of Governors and the chairs of governors’ committees in publishing agendas and minutes of governors’ committee meetings.
  • To produce the daily morning briefing.
  • To communicate with parents as necessary
  • To assist with the compilation of the staff handbook.
  • To act as a Fire Warden.
  • To cover Reception, when required.
  • To undertake school First Aid for students and staff, contact parents and reporting all accidents on the online system.
  • The post holder may be required to work flexibly on occasions to enable school deadlines to be met. This may include occasional additional hours or changes to starting/finishing times.
  • HR related duties such as arranging teacher cover, process staff salary forms, updating SIMS, checking DBS, vetting staff, organising campaigns etc.
  • Any other PA and administrative support duties as necessary.
